The cheapest way to get from Reston to Floyd is to drive which costs $45 - $70 and takes 5h 4m.
The fastest way to get from Reston to Floyd is to fly and drive which takes 4h 16m and costs $85 - $550.
No, there is no direct bus from Reston to Floyd. However, there are services departing from Dulles International Airport and arriving at Christiansburg via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 1m.
The distance between Reston and Floyd is 271 miles. The road distance is 254.2 miles.
The best way to get from Reston to Floyd without a car is to bus which takes 6h 1m and costs $90 - $120.
It takes approximately 6h 1m to get from Reston to Floyd, including transfers.
Reston to Floyd bus services, operated by Virginia Breeze, depart from Dulles International Airport station.
Reston to Floyd bus services, operated by Virginia Breeze, arrive at Christiansburg station.
Yes, the driving distance between Reston to Floyd is 254 miles. It takes approximately 5h 4m to drive from Reston to Floyd.

What companies run services between Reston, VA, USA and Floyd, VA, USA?
Virginia Breeze operates a bus from Dulles International Airport to Christiansburg twice daily. Tickets cost $35–45 and the journey takes 4h 20m.
